Also known as KSN; Kidney Support Network

Closed
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Health, Accommodation, Advocacy Service, Charities and charitable organisations, Chronic Disease management, Community Transport, Counselling Service, Health support and information organisation, Healthy Lifestyle, Hospital Outpatients, Medical Equipment and Supplies, Self Help and Support Group
Provision of Peer Support and Personalised support services to people impacted by chronic kidney disease

Eligibility

No referral required. Appointment required. No waiting list.
Kidney Patient; diagnosed with kidney failure; family member or Carer of a kidney patient

Charges and Fees

Private
Most support services are free. Patient transport requires membership to Kidney Support Network and a nominal contribution to transport cost applies.
